A cool driver treats their vehicle with respect. They allow the engine to reach operating temperature before driving aggressively, check tire pressures regularly, and never ignore warning lights. They understand that a well-maintained vehicle performs better, lasts longer, and remains dependable in emergencies. Distraction Eradication
